So I got my tx240 radiator. It is 123.5 mm wide. 3.5mm - 4mm of which are part of the fan attachment bar and not the actual core of the radiator. I am absolutely certain that with minimal modification (i.e. Sanding, hammering in, or cutting off part of the fan bracket) I can fit this radiator in the bottom of Mjolnir. My only question now is sticking a second one parallel to my GPU for a double radiator loop in Mjolnir. (I believe this is possible but I may need to leave the side panel un-attached and have the fans protruding out through the gap where the side panel magnetically clips on 😆) Any and all input is welcome, im interested in everyone's ideas on building a custom loop in Mjolnir!
